The lesson “Integrity” teaches children how to effectively demonstrate healthy and compassionate interpersonal relationship skills through the understanding of the concept of integrity. Each child will be able to give a definition for the word, ‘integrity,’ as well as explain the difference in behavior of a person who has integrity as compared to someone who does not. Children will have the opportunity to demonstrate behaviors of integrity, such as honesty and dependability. The lesson includes guided instructions for the teacher, including preparation, a script, and suggested activities to facilitate further learning in a fun and interactive manner. This lesson is designed for children between 6-8 years, and is the 41st lesson in the 2nd Year Core Curriculum Set and part of the “Leadership Preparation” unit.
